Isle of the Dead

Isle of the Dead

They're more than dead!

Strangers trapped on a secluded island struggle to survive against hordes of the dead.

Release Date 2016-12-02
Budget N/A
Revenue N/A
Rating 4.8/10
Runtime 90 mins